The color and turbidity of iron and manganese, which are dissolved in the waters, cause bacterial proliferation. Especially in the textile, plastic, paper, leather and food industry, undesirable results occur in the production. Thanks to the special filtration mineral used in the filters, up to 5 ppm of iron and up to 2 ppm of manganese can be purified. The molten iron, which is filtered at low speeds through the special mineral, is oxidized and filtered between the layers. Iron and manganese thrown out by backwashing are removed from the water. There is no need for regenerative material during the backwashing. However, for iron content higher than 5 ppm and manganese content higher than 2 ppm, it is possible to solve the problems by using regenerative material in the backwashing with different filtration mineral.
